PostPosted: Fri Oct 24, 2003 2:40 pm    Post subject: Reply with quote

hi,

hmm...there could be mani reasons...

do u all haf s/w firewalls like zonealarm?? if u do have, make sure tat connection rights have been given to the necessary mySQL programs. I tried this last time when i have a red light. now it's working.

os17fan's tutorials r really comprehensive, just tat there are some things to take note of. when u typed http://localhost/phpmyadmin, also include the port number where abyss web server is running if urs is a no. other than 80. it couldnt work for me initially. only when i changed it to: http://localhost:8080/phpmyadmin, then it works.

PostPosted: Mon Mar 15, 2004 3:16 am    Post subject: Reply with quote

Someone noted that there was a "REDIRECT_STATUS" problem. Remember, in the CGI Perameters, set REDIRECT_STATUS to "200" in the Abyss console.
